Leafy greens increase testosterone

Eating more leafy greens can improve your levels of testosterone. These vegetables contain magnesium, an essential building block of the male hormone. They also reduce oestrogen, a factor that can decrease testosterone levels. Other vegetables with testosterone-boosting properties include asparagus and garlic. Dark leafy greens, in particular, contain magnesium and antioxidants. These nutrients help the body reduce oxidative stress, which can damage the cells that produce testosterone.

Besides being rich in magnesium, leafy greens also contain boron, a nutrient linked to increased testosterone levels. Onions increase testosterone production

Onions are a natural food that increase testosterone production in men. They are a great source of antioxidants and nutrients that improve the heart and waistline. In 2012, a study using a rat model found that consuming fresh onion juice daily for four weeks improved serum total testosterone levels. More studies are needed to determine if these results can be applied to humans. In addition to enhancing testosterone production, onions also improve blood pressure and protect against prostate cancer.
